[Dresden-pm] lc

Torsten Werner email at twerner42.de
Sam Jan 15 02:42:49 PST 2005


Hallo Steffen(se),

> Ich denke mal, lc erwartet einen scalar und wenn man ein Array im scalaren
> Kontext auf ruft hat man die Länge von @a in $[0] stehen, ist das nicht
> logisch genug. Wenn man wo anders anderes denkt, dann würde ich das eher als
> Vielfalt und nicht als falsch bezeichnen. Perl ist gut aber andere sind doch
> auch nicht doof.

die Begründung ist schon klar, aber wer wird denn jemals 'lc @array' 
aufrufen, um die Anzahl der Elemente von @array ge-lower-case-d zu 
bekommen? Das ergibt doch gar keinen Sinn! Das einzig sinnvolle Ergebnis 
ist doch, das eben genau 'map { lc } @array' ausgeführt wird. Warum 
wurde lc in perl nicht so implementiert?

Viele Grüße,
Torsten